In a Licchavi-era inscription found in Tistung, the local people have been addressed as the 'Nepals'. Experts are of the opinion that some or all of the inhabitants of Nepal in the ancient period were likely called 'Nepals', which meant that the word 'Nepal' was used to refer to both the land and its population. These Nepals are considered the progenitors of modern-day Newars. Nowadays 'Nepali' is one of the more respectful terms, alongside the terms 'Nepal' and 'Newar'…

WebJun 6, 2015 · Khyak and Murkutta. Murkutta is a skeleton. They are moving bag of bones. Khyak is the opposite. It is a boneless mass. It is all flesh and has long black hair all over. There is this idea of a black and white khyak, black khyak being the scary one and the white being the good guy who even fulfills your wishes.
